    The Nikon 50mm 1.4g lens is an excellent choice for any SLR user. It is a little heavier than the Nikon 50mm 1.8g, but the weight is balanced by it's exceptional light gathering capabilities. You can shoot without a flash indoors even at night. The 1.4 aperture also provides excellent depth of field control with awesome bokeh effects. The price is great for a lens of this quality and features. Metal mount, rear seal gasket, and internal silent wave motor focusing system are a few of the premium features you'll appreciate with this lens. A little more expensive than the excellent Nikon 50mm 1.8g, the 50mm 1.4g offers excellent value for long term ownership. Every SLR owner should have a 50mm lens and this is an excellent choice! Once you use the 50mm, you'll find it will be your go to lens for any shooting situation. I use mine 90% of the time...

    Here is what I like about the Nikon 50mm 1.4 lens: It is short and light to carry. It looks great on my D7000. The manual focusing ring is smooth and the long travel allows for very easy, fine focusing adjustments. The Auto/Manual focus switch works well. This lens is as sharp as anything else I have ever owned. (but not at f1.4) Here is what I am not so happy with: The lens is the slowest to achieve auto focus I have ever owned. Images taken at f1.4 look like I had some kind of medium strength “soft focus” filter on the lens.

    So far I am really enjoying using this 50mm f/1.4 lens. It has fast autofocus, good bokah, is small, lightweight, and yields sharp images when it hits focus on my D800. But this is my first "modern" G series lens, after using nothing but older AF-D and manual focus lenses on my Nikons, so I don't have the same perspective or presumptions as other "professional" reviewers have who generally panned this lens's performance. Regardless, if you can get this lens on sale, it is a great addition if you need a fast prime 50mm F-mount lens. The only downside is that it takes 58mm lens filters, so all my 52mm filters I use on my older prime lenses won't fit.

    I bought this lens as my goto for portraits on my DX cameras, but also as my see in the extreme dark lens. 1.4 gathers 2/3 of a stop more light than 1.8 and when you need it, it matters. This lens would also be a great first lens if you are considering an FX body, or even with the new Z 6 or Z 7 and it’s adaptor. Nothing not to like.
